Got my BSD and it has had intermittent probs with the 24" opto switch. Sometimes it works and sometimes it doesn't!! So re-flowed every joint on the board and it starting working again - for a couple of days!! Next I replaced L1 inductor and again it started working for a couple of days!!!

Getting well hacked off with it now. Anyone any ideas what else to do with it - would like to fix it rather than just binning it ?

Try changing the connector, both plug and pins...

Look for breaks in the wires somewhere. My dead optos and switches was due to a wire that had snapped off took ages to find
 
My Mist multiball was playing up the other day, it indicated problems with various optos not working - turns out it was just bad connections. Sod to diagnose though
